What is Augmentin 625 Glaxosmithkline? – Background and function in sport
Augmentin 625, produced by GlaxoSmithKline, is a combination antibiotic that contains amoxicillin and clavulanic acid. This medication is primarily used to treat various bacterial infections, particularly those that may be resistant to other antibiotics. Tips for safe use: medical consultation
Before using Augmentin 625, medical consultation is imperative. Here are essential tips for safe usage:
1. Discuss Medical History: Make sure to provide a comprehensive medical history to your physician, including any allergic reactions and existing medical conditions.
2. Follow Prescription Guidelines: Always adhere to the dosage and duration prescribed by your healthcare provider, as improper use can lead to antibiotic resistance.
3. Monitor for Side Effects: Be aware of potential side effects such as nausea, diarrhea, or allergic reactions. Report any significant concerns to your doctor immediately.
4. Avoid Self-Medication: Never use Augmentin or any antibiotic for self-diagnosed conditions or without a prescription.
By following these guidelines, you can ensure the responsible and safe use of Augmentin in supporting your athletic endeavors.
